    1969 Corvette Rear Compartment & Spare Tire Lock & Keys

    1969 Experts - Is there any info on the use of "K" letter code keys & locks* instead of the "H" letter code keys for the rear compartment & spare tire locks on the late/very late production 1969 Corvettes. The 1969 Corvette we're dealing with does
    have the typical "E" letter code keyway ignition & door locks.

    *FYI - We have found mention on a Camaro website that late production vehicles & fleet vehicles could have used the next years,
    1970, keyway locks & keys which would have been the "K" letter code locks & keys.

    Any info on the use of 1970 "K" letter code locks & keys on the late/very late 1969 Corvettes is appreciated. Thanks, Pete

      Pete,
      Your question rang a bell with me. I own a very late production (Dec 15 1969) car. I first bought it in 1996 as a restored car that had already earned Gold at Bloomington. Looking through my notes on the car and flight judging sheets I found the rectangular key was coded E and the oval key was coded K. I sold the car in 2001 and bought it back in 2009. It now has H coded oval keys. I can not remember if I had the K code changed or if it was done during the 8 years I did not own the car. As I said the car was restored before I bought it in 1996 so I can not say for sure that it left the factory with the K coded keys.
